Output 57b3e7bb6619a35c6efacf1e433ac31bd366b675459997890542bbe9258f5bf2:1

value
597626623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b23ada38340251776b361f975dc637e063d9d47 OP_EQUALVERIFY OP_CHECKSIG
address
D7cbXQccSZeMBKqF4RM79JdAHDhybKzRPG
transaction
57b3e7bb6619a35c6efacf1e433ac31bd366b675459997890542bbe9258f5bf2